Apologies for what might sound like a stupid question - but ...
How can I tell if a TFT LCD screen is compatible with Teensy3.6?
A while ago, I bought a 3.5" TFT LCD touch screen for a Raspberry Pi project (so I know the screen works).
But I'm now wondering if I can use it in a Teensy (3.6) based project I have.
I don't need the 'touch' screen functionality - it's literally just for displaying text.
I have no real knowledge of TFT screens & how they work & what makes them compatible etc.
This is the only other info I have on it:
Type :TFT
Interface :SPI
Touch panel control chip : XPT2046
The color index : 65536
Backlight: LED
resolving power: 320×480 (Pixel)
Size proportion: 8:5
power waste: TBD
Back facet current: TBD
Working temperature (c): TBD
Interface definition:
TFT Pin number/ identification/ description
1、17 3.3V ------ Power supply positive (3.3V power input)
2、4 5V -- ---- Power supply positive (5V power input)
3、5、7、8、10、12、13、15、16 NC --- --- NC
6、9、14、20、25 GND ------- Power GND
11 TP_IRQ ------ Touch panel interrupt, detect the touch panel is pressed down to a low level
18 LCD_RS ------- Instruction / data register selection
19 LCD_SI / TP_SI ------ LCD display / touch panel SPI data input
21 TP_SO ----- SPI data output of touch panel
22 RST ----- reset
23 LCD_SCK / TP_SCK LCD -------- SPI clock signal for display / touch panel
24 LCD_CS -------- LCD chip select signal, low level LCD
26 TP_CS --------- The touch panel chip select signal, low level selection of touch panel
If by any chance the answer is yes. Any idea what the corresponding Teensy pins would be pls.
